"Help meeeee! Heeeeeeelp meeeeeeeee!" Put David Cronenberg, Plácido Domingo, Howard Shore and David Henry Hwang together and they'll give you something to remember... "The Fly: The Opera". Dopeness abounds in this sickly 80's scarefest reworked to the LA Opera scene. Time magazine described "The Fly" as "a profound parable on love and loss." And we say Cronenberg is the king of body horror and what better way to revisit this lonely, dark sterile look at the 80's than Placido Domingo producing the Opera version. In its metamorphosis into an opera, this dark romantic tragedy presents a Kafkaesque meditation on man's uneasy relationship with technology. As the doomed scientist Seth Brundle (Jeff Goldblum) and his girlfriend Veronica Quaife (Geena Davis) battle some big issues with back hair....
